Output 84df8897208384f7f149127c99ff3ce13bf78489b10b5e2188bdfd2bfaaff72f:0

value
18024145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d48f737c7162636ebf133219bc9c70846e8eee OP_EQUAL
address
3Dyw7Ce2FP4sqbkkPaxwZvYFzwobP6XDDj
transaction
84df8897208384f7f149127c99ff3ce13bf78489b10b5e2188bdfd2bfaaff72f
confirmations
461199
spent
true